    Sacha Baron Cohen has gone to "extreme" lengths not to be recognized

    The 47-year-old actor is known for his bold characters - including Kazakh journalist Borat Sagdiyev and dictator Admiral General Aladeen - and his mockumentaries often rely on his ability to go undercover as he meets ordinary people


    He admitted that filming 'Who Is America?' made him realise he "had to do more extreme stuff" as people started to recognise his face, so he turned to makeup and special effects designer Tony Gardner.

    Speaking to Don Cheadle for Variety's Actors on Actors, he added: "I went to him: 'Do you think you could create prosthetics good enough that they would exist in the real world? Because I can't be touched for three hours."

    But the 'Bruno' star admitted he never wanted to take his looks "too far", and explained he has also always wanted to avoid harming anyone while doing his best to see their "real thoughts".

    He said: "I don't want anyone to get hurt, but I want to see people's real thoughts. I'm provoking them sometimes to see the effect of this new political culture that we're in."
